THE MINISTER OF TRADE

Pursuant to Decree No. 95/CP dated December 4, 1993 of the Government on the functions, tasks, powers, and organizational structure of the Ministry of Trade;

Pursuant to Decree No. 20/1999/NĐ-CP dated April 12, 1999 of the Government on trading services of commodity inspection;

Pursuant to Decision No. 651/TTg dated October 10, 1995 of the Prime Minister on the establishment of the National Committee for Coordinating Vietnam's Activities in ASEAN;

Pursuant to Circular No. 356/VPUB dated January 22, 1996 of the Government on the designation of the agency issuing certificates of origin for goods according to the CEPT Agreement;

At the proposal of the Director of the Import-Export Department;

Pursuant to …;

Article 1:

1\. Amend Clause 2 of Article 5 of the Rules for Issuing Certificates of Origin for ASEAN Goods of Vietnam - Form D to Enjoy Preferential Treatment under the "ASEAN Framework Agreement on Common Effective Preferential Tariff Treatment (CEPT)" issued together with Decision No. 416/TM-ĐB dated May 13, 1996 of the Minister of Trade.

2\. Issue Appendix 4 (amended) on Procedures for Requesting Inspection and Issuing Certificates of Origin Inspection for Form D, replacing Appendix 4 of the aforementioned Rules.

Article 2:

This Decision shall take effect from the date of signing.

Article 3:

The Director of the Import-Export Department, heads of relevant agencies under the Ministry of Trade shall be responsible for implementing and guiding the implementation of this Decision.

Certificate of Origin for ASEAN Goods of Vietnam - Form D to Enjoy Preferential Treatment under the "ASEAN Framework Agreement on Common Effective Preferential Tariff Treatment (CEPT)" issued together with Decision No. 416/TM-ĐB dated May 13, 1996 of the Minister of Trade (issued together with Decision No. 492/2000/QĐ-BTM dated March 20, 2000 of the Minister of Trade) II/ PROCEDURES FOR ISSUING FORM D CERTIFICATE

Article 5. Documents for requesting issuance of Form D Certificate include:

2\. Certificate of Origin Inspection for goods (in cases where inspection is required). This certificate must meet the following requirements: - Comply with the Origin Regulations stipulated in Appendix 1 attached hereto, and; - Be issued by a business entity engaged in commodity inspection services in accordance with Appendix 4 (amended) of these Rules;
